CCME — Cellebrite Certified Mobile Examiner

Cellebrite's senior mobile examiner credential, positioned above the operator and physical-analyst certifications and renewed through continuing education plus a competency assessment.

Renewal
Renewal requires 21 continuing-education credits plus completion of Cellebrite's CASA competency assessment.

Strengths

  • The senior credential in the most widely deployed mobile forensics toolchain, which carries weight with law-enforcement reviewers.
  • Renewal combines continuing education with a competency assessment rather than credits alone.

Limitations

  • Neither the cost nor the exam structure is published, so a prospective candidate cannot evaluate it without contacting sales.
  • Tool-specific by construction.
  • No accreditation body is named.
  • Because the public documentation is thin, we can describe the renewal requirements but not the assessment itself — treat the format as unconfirmed.
